This opening is for the 2026-2027 school year.
QUALIFICATIONS:
Education - A valid license issued by the Missouri State Board of Social Work LCSW, Board of Professional Counselors LPC, or Missouri State Committee of Psychologists as a licensed psychologist.
Knowledge/Skills - Knowledge of child and adolescent development, family dynamics, various therapeutic modalities, dialectical skills, and evidence-based interventions, plus a workable knowledge of school law, policies, and special education. Current awareness of mental health disorders and challenges facing students. Skilled at individual and group counseling, case management, crisis intervention, conducting individual and/or family assessments, and collaborating with other professionals within and outside of the school district. Ability to partner and relate effectively with students, their families, and all school faculty. Knowledge of trauma-informed principles, including the ability to articulate best SEL practices and alternatives to exclusionary discipline, including restorative school practices.
Experience - Previous experience in counseling/social work with school-age students. Work experience in a school setting is preferred.
